Output 4f0493b72bdc107e30aa9a631539f46055cbf165bc4c91a2c59f90c426e5057b:3

value
20807997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ad91f288f6ae385cdddffb00c04f934c67c961 OP_EQUAL
address
3JFeA8MESjmkeumRAUakfGxieG6UfkfL6c
transaction
4f0493b72bdc107e30aa9a631539f46055cbf165bc4c91a2c59f90c426e5057b
spent
true